The recent winter tourism promotion conference held in Chengdu on December 24, 2023, highlights a significant intersection between culture and seasonal travel, particularly as Baoji seeks to brand itself as a premier winter destination. With the snowy allure of Qinling paired with the vibrant culinary traditions of Sichuan and Chongqing, this initiative underscores the increasing trend of experiential travel that allows visitors to immerse themselves in both nature and local customs. This new venture could transform perceptions of Baoji and encourage wider regional exploration.

The initiative reveals a rich tapestry of local culture, notably through the presentation of the original play "Piel de fideos". This theatrical piece resonates with the narrative of Baoji’s socio-economic developments, celebrating regional specialties while addressing broader themes like poverty alleviation and rural revitalization. Visitors are not just passive recipients of beautiful landscapes; they are invited to engage with local stories that echo their own experiences. As one attendee noted, the play's connection to personal struggles mirrors universal entrepreneurial challenges, hinting at the socio-cultural underpinnings that attract tourists seeking authenticity and meaningful connections.

Overall, the conference serves as a bridge between past and present, encouraging tourism that is grounded in local traditions while promoting the commercial benefits of winter travel.
